Player profile


6599ce3749bc1.image.jpg


  • Height 6-6
  • Weight 210
  • Class Grad Senior
  • Hometown Brooklyn, N.Y.
  • Highschool South Shore / Brewster Academy
2022-23: Preseason All-BIG EAST Second Team … Twice named to the BIG EAST Weekly Honor Roll … Had his best season as a collegian statistically, setting career highs in scoring (10.1 points per game), rebounding (5.2 rpg), minutes (27.6 mpg), three-point percentage (44 percent), free throw attempts (101) and free throws made (70) … Matched his career high with 53 steals and averaged more 4.0 assists per contest for the second consecutive season … Led the team in rebounding in BIG EAST play, averaging 5.5 rebounds per game, and finished second in scoring with 11.8 points per game … Finished in a three-way tie for first in the BIG EAST averaging 2.0 steals per game … Finished ninth in the conference in assist-to-turnover ratio (1.9 a/to) and seventh with 4.6 defensive rebounds per game … Posted five games with at least five assists and scored in double figures 14 times … Season was cut short with a back injury that forced him to miss the last five games the season … Led the Pirates in scoring with 17 points at Kansas (12/1), also adding five rebounds and five assists … Matched his career-high with six steals in the road win over Rutgers (12/11), becoming first pirate since Quincy McKnight in 2019 to hit that mark … Exploded for a career-high 28 points and matched his career best with nine rebounds against Providence (12/17) … Had a great all-around game on New Year’s Eve against St. John’s with 19 points, nine rebounds and six assists … Flirted with a triple-double against Butler (1/7), finishing with 11 points, nine assists and eight rebounds … Secured his second career double-double with 18 points and 10 rebounds against UConn (1/18) … Finished with 15 points, 13 boards and 7 assists at St. John’s (2/1), the first such game by a Pirate since at least 2010.

2021-22: Started 26 of 32 games for the Pirates... Became the primary starting point guard the second half of the season ... Averaged 8.8 points, 3.6 rebounds, 4.1 assists, and 1.7 steals per game … Ranked fourth in the conference in assists per game and fifth in steals per game….Had 13 points, five rebounds, three assists, and two steals against Yale (11/14) ... Recorded 10 points, nine assists, eight rebounds, and four steals in a victory over Wagner (12/1) ... Delivered a career-high 27 points, including 17 straight, on 10-of-13 shooting in an overtime victory against UConn (1/8) ... Tallied a season-high 5 steals to go along with 11 points and 4 assists against No. 22 Marquette (1/15) ... Recorded a career-high eight rebounds to go along with 12 points, seven assists, and three steals in a victory over Georgetown (2/1) ... Tallied 14 points, three rebounds, and seven assists in a victory over Creighton at the Prudential Center (2/4) ... Scored 16 points and dished out five assists at Villanova (2/12) ... Recorded 12 points and five rebounds while tying his career-high in assists with 10 against Georgetown (3/2) ... Helped the Pirates beat Georgetown in the first round of the BIG EAST Tournament (3/11) with nine points, three assists, and two rebounds.

BEFORE SETON HALL: Played in 28 games and averaged 6.3 points, 2.3 rebounds and 21 minutes per game as a freshman at Syracuse ... Ranked third on the team with 86 assists ... Recorded a personal-best 10 assists and snagged four steals in the home win against North Carolina ... Tallied eight points, two rebounds, and two blocks in the NCAA Tournament victory against San Diego State ... Helped Syracuse to an upset victory against #16/14 Virginia Tech with 13 points off the bench ... Had seven assists and five steals at Rutgers ... Made his first career start against Niagara and recorded 16 points, seven rebounds, six assists, four steals and three blocks in the win.

PERSONAL: Kadary Richmond was born in Brooklyn, N.Y., in 2001 ... He is the son of Florence Etienne ... He has two brothers, Daquan and Farrell, and two sisters, Kiara and Flarissa ... 2020 First Team All-New England Prep School Athletic Council (NEPSAC) at Brewster Academy ... 2019 New York City Public School Player of the Year at South Shore High School in Brooklyn.
